CONSUMER PROTECTION — RENTAL TENANCY COMPLAINTS
942. Hon WILSON TUCKER to the Minister for Finance:
I thank the minister for her answer
to my question asked yesterday regarding division 2A of the Residential Tenancies Act 1987. I note that the Residential
Tenancies Legislation Amendment (Family Violence) Act 2019, other than
part 1, commenced on 15 April 2019. Has a statutory review of the provisions of
the amendment act been completed; and, if so, where can the review be found?

AnswerView source ↗
I thank the honourable member for
some notice of the question.
The statutory review is being
finalised. The report on the review will be tabled in Parliament as soon as
practicable.
